A Quiet But Strong Film Career
Carlos Scola Pliego began working in film in the late 1970s and early 1980s. He started with smaller roles, such as a script supervisor, where he helped make sure the story flowed correctly from scene to scene. He also worked as an assistant director, supporting other filmmakers and learning the ins and outs of directing.
One of his most recognized credits is working as the second assistant director for the film Never Say Never Again in 1983. This was a James Bond film starring Sean Connery and Kim Basinger, and Carlos helped manage parts of the production that were shot in Spain. Being involved in a film of that scale shows his professional talent and trustworthiness on set.
Later, he also worked on the 1985 miniseries Christopher Columbus, which explored the famous explorer’s life and journeys. In 1988, he directed a documentary called Ngira: Gorilas en la Montaña, which followed gorillas in their natural habitat. The following year, he released another documentary titled Donde Termina el Corazón, giving a look into African life and culture. These projects show Carlos’s interest in both nature and human stories.
How He Met Sade Adu
Carlos Scola Pliego’s life changed forever when he met Sade Adu, the British-Nigerian singer known for her deep voice and timeless music. Their paths crossed in Spain, during the filming of three music videos for her 1985 album Promise. These videos were directed by Brian Ward, and Carlos was involved in the production.
At the time, Sade was going through personal struggles, including the loss of her father. She found peace in Spain and ended up reconnecting with Carlos during that time. Their friendship turned into something more, and they soon became very close. Although they kept things private, it was clear that they supported each other deeply, both emotionally and creatively.
By 1987, while Sade was recording in France, she began referring to Carlos as her husband, even though they hadn’t officially married yet. Their bond was strong, and Carlos often joined her in the studio while she worked on her music. It was a love story built on quiet support, shared passion, and mutual respect.
Their Marriage And Life Together
In 1989, Carlos Scola Pliego and Sade Adu officially got married. Their wedding was held at a beautiful Spanish castle, and it was a private yet grand celebration. Surrounded by close friends and family, they exchanged vows and began their life as husband and wife.
After the wedding, they lived together in Madrid, Spain. There, they created a home that was peaceful and filled with shared memories. Even though Sade was a global superstar, she found calmness in her life with Carlos. The couple stayed away from the public eye and focused on their personal bond.
During this time, Carlos continued his work in film while Sade recorded more music. They were both artists in different fields, and they supported each other in meaningful ways. Their love story was never about fame—it was about connection, comfort, and companionship.
Why They Divorced After Six Years
Sadly, the relationship between Carlos Scola Pliego and Sade Adu didn’t last forever. After about six years of marriage, they decided to separate. Their divorce was finalized in 1995. Even though their love had been strong, something changed along the way.
The couple never gave a public explanation about why they ended their marriage. Sade has only briefly spoken about it, calling it a “very bad situation.” She admitted that it took her several years to fully heal from the experience, which shows how deeply the breakup affected her.

Life After The Spotlight
After his divorce from Sade Adu, Carlos Scola Pliego stepped even further away from the public eye. While Sade continued her music career, Carlos kept his life private. He appeared in one more film project in 2007 as a crew member for Goal II: Living the Dream, but there hasn’t been much public work from him since then.
Outside of film, Carlos has also written books. One of his known works is El Médico de Toledo, which tells the story of a Jewish family facing hardship during the time of the Spanish Inquisition. He also wrote Salvador: Un Apunte de Filosofía Sencilla, a short reflection on philosophy and life.
